Rice weighing 33/4 pounds was divided equally and placed in 4 containers. How many ounces of rice were in each?
QveST [7]

Answer:

The answer is 15 ounces

Step-by-step explanation:

33/4 ÷ 4 pounds.

(4 × 3 + 3)/4 ÷ 4 pounds.

15/4 ÷ 4 pounds.

15/4 × 1/4 pounds.

15/16 pounds.

Now we know that, 1 pound = 16 ounces.

So, 15/16 pounds = 15/16 × 16 ounces = 15 ounces.

Thus, The answer is 15 ounces
